What are the reasons for recommending (according to the main post) unchecked CPU moves and battle time limit?
Do AIs move hastily with time limit on, even like with 60 minutes? Does seeing CPU moves affect anything gameplay wise besides its feature?
Last edited by Lord Davn; January 16, 2018 at 10:05 PM.
The CPU moves take considerable time and gives the human player an unfair advantage of seeing moves by the AI. Disabling them gives you a more realistic feel for the fog of war (or what's my enemy up to now)
Removing the battle time limit helps with the NTW3 mod (because we've slowed down the pace of battle) which gives you more time to plan tactical moves when playing a drop-in opponent or even the AI in large battles.

I would like to ask you a question, what can I do to enable fire by rank in campaign??
Last edited by Lord Davn; January 18, 2018 at 09:24 AM.
We disabled the fire by rank because of some problems that it caused with our NTW3 mod battle stats and added the skirmish ability which allows the first and second ranks to fire. This is more historically accurate which is what our NTW3 mods are all about. They typically did not fire from the third ranks because the muzzle blast would often go off in the ears of the first rank soldiers.
